Kinds Of Home Exercise Bikes
Home exercise bikes been available in numerous designs, each catering to different preferences and exercise cycle bike goals. Below is an introduction of the most typical types:

Upright Bikes
Upright bikes exercise for sale are created to imitate outdoor cycling with a straight-up seating posture. They are ideal for users seeking a full-body exercise bike for house while improving cardiovascular fitness.
2. Recumbent Bikes
These bikes enable the user to being in a reclined position with back assistance, making them ideal for older grownups or those recovering from injuries. The style decreases strain on the back while still using a cardiovascular workout.
3. Spin Bikes
Spin bikes are constructed for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and are often used in spinning classes. They include adjustable stress to mimic biking on various surfaces. These bikes are especially popular amongst fitness lovers who wish to press their limitations.
4. Hybrid Bikes
A mix of upright and recumbent designs, hybrid bikes accommodate a variety of users by allowing seat adjustments for different riding positions.

Caring for a stationary bicycle exercise bicycle can extend its lifespan and guarantee a top quality exercise experience. Here are necessary maintenance tips:

How much space do I need for a home exercise bike?
The majority of stationary bicycle require a space of about 5 to 10 square feet, depending upon the design. Consider additional area for comfort and movement.
2. Are stationary bicycle appropriate for all fitness levels?
Yes, stationary bicycle accommodate all fitness levels. Adjustable resistance and seat setups make them accessible for newbies and specialists alike.
3. How typically should I use a home stationary bicycle?
For optimum outcomes, go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week. This can correspond to about 30 minutes of biking each day, five times a week.
4. Do I need special shoes for spin bikes?
While not mandatory, cycling shoes are suggested for spin bikes as they provide better assistance and permit you to clip into the pedals for improved control.
5. How do I choose the right bike for my needs?
Examine your fitness goals, evaluate readily available space, and consider spending plan restraints. It may also be useful to evaluate trip different designs before purchasing.
